GPS Signal Accuracy

When it comes to GPS speedometer HUDs, signal accuracy is crucial for reliable speed tracking. These devices typically use military-grade satellite technology to deliver precise speed readings across different vehicles. However, keep in mind that signal accuracy can vary, with deviations of 0.6 to 1.8 MPH being common due to environmental factors like obstructions and weather. You’ll find ideal performance in open areas with clear satellite visibility, while tunnels or heavy rain can disrupt the signal. Look for HUDs that connect to multiple satellites to enhance stability and accuracy. Finally, verify your GPS speedometer is powered by a reliable 5V source to maintain consistent performance and avoid inaccuracies while driving.

Power Source Options

Brightness adjustment technology enhances the driving experience, but you also need to take into account how your GPS speedometer HUD will be powered. Most models use a standard 5V USB port, making installation a breeze without complex wiring. You can also choose options like a USB interface or a cigarette lighter car charger, giving you flexibility across different vehicles. Just remember to avoid high-voltage or fast-charging adapters, as they can damage the device. Many HUDs come with automatic power-on and off features, activating with your vehicle’s accessory power to save energy. Plus, their low power consumption guarantees they won’t drain your car’s battery when connected properly, allowing for a worry-free driving experience.
